Google Java Style:深度解析Java编程的最佳实践

一、引言
Google Java Style,顾名思义,就是Google公司针对Java编程语言制定的一系列编码规范。这些规范旨在提高代码的可读性、可维护性和可扩展性。作为一名资深站长和SEO专家,我深知良好的编程规范对于网站优化和搜索引擎排名的重要性。本文将深入解析Google Java Style,分享我的真实经验。
二、Google Java Style的核心原则
1. 代码可读性
Google Java Style强调代码的可读性,认为良好的代码应该易于理解。以下是一些提高代码可读性的原则:
(1)使用有意义的变量和函数名,避免使用缩写或缩写词。
(2)遵循一致的命名规范,如驼峰命名法。
(3)使用空格、缩进和换行,使代码结构清晰。
(4)注释要简洁明了,避免冗长和重复。
2. 代码可维护性
Google Java Style注重代码的可维护性,以下是一些提高代码可维护性的原则:
(1)遵循单一职责原则,将功能模块化。
(2)避免过度耦合,提高模块间的独立性。
(3)遵循DRY(Don't Repeat Yourself)原则,避免代码重复。
(4)使用设计模式,提高代码的可扩展性和可复用性。
3. 代码可扩展性
Google Java Style强调代码的可扩展性,以下是一些提高代码可扩展性的原则:
(1)使用接口和抽象类,降低耦合度。
(2)遵循开闭原则,使代码易于扩展。
(3)使用泛型和模板,提高代码的通用性。
(4)合理使用继承和多态,提高代码的复用性。
三、Google Java Style的具体实践
1. 代码格式
Google Java Style对代码格式有严格的要求,以下是一些具体的实践:
(1)使用2个空格进行缩进,避免使用Tab键。
(2)每个方法、类和文件应以空行开始和结束。
(3)方法之间、类之间应使用空行分隔。
(4)使用大括号括起来的代码块应遵循正确的缩进。
2. 变量和函数命名
Google Java Style对变量和函数命名有明确的要求:
(1)使用有意义的变量和函数名,避免使用缩写或缩写词。
(2)遵循驼峰命名法,如userCount、getUserInfo。
(3)常量命名应使用全大写,如MAX_SIZE、DEFAULT_VALUE。
3. 注释
Google Java Style对注释有严格的要求:
(1)注释要简洁明了,避免冗长和重复。
(2)使用文档注释,方便生成API文档。
(3)避免在代码中添加不必要的注释。
4. 异常处理
Google Java Style对异常处理有明确的要求:
(1)使用try-catch块捕获异常,避免在方法中直接抛出异常。
(2)避免使用System.out.println()打印异常信息,使用日志记录。
(3)遵循异常处理的最佳实践,如自定义异常类。
四、总结
Google Java Style是Java编程的最佳实践,遵循这些规范可以提高代码的质量。作为一名资深站长和SEO专家,我深知良好的编程规范对于网站优化和搜索引擎排名的重要性。在今后的工作中,我将不断学习和实践Google Java Style,为网站优化和SEO工作提供更好的支持。
总之,Google Java Style不仅是一种编程规范,更是一种编程哲学。通过遵循这些规范,我们可以写出更加清晰、易读、易维护和易扩展的代码。作为一名Java开发者,我们应该努力提高自己的编程水平,将Google Java Style融入到我们的日常工作中。






